Effective Shower Tile Sealing: A Step-By-Step Guide For Long-Lasting Protection

how to seal shower tiles

Sealing shower tiles is a crucial step in maintaining the longevity and appearance of your bathroom. Over time, grout and tiles can become susceptible to water damage, mold, and mildew, which not only detract from the aesthetic appeal but can also lead to costly repairs. By applying a high-quality sealant, you create a protective barrier that repels water, prevents stains, and inhibits the growth of harmful microorganisms. This process is relatively straightforward and can be accomplished with basic tools and materials, making it an accessible DIY project for homeowners. Properly sealed shower tiles not only enhance the durability of your bathroom but also ensure a cleaner, healthier environment for years to come.

Prepare Surface: Clean tiles thoroughly, removing soap scum, dirt, and old sealant for proper adhesion

Before applying any sealant, the shower tiles must be pristine. Imagine painting a wall without sanding or priming—the result would be uneven, prone to peeling, and short-lived. Similarly, sealant adheres best to a clean, smooth surface free of contaminants. Soap scum, mildew, hard water stains, and remnants of old sealant create barriers that prevent proper bonding, leading to premature failure.

Begin by removing all surface debris. Use a non-abrasive scrub brush or sponge with a tile-safe cleaner. For stubborn soap scum, mix equal parts white vinegar and water, applying it directly to affected areas and letting it sit for 10–15 minutes before scrubbing. Avoid acidic cleaners on natural stone tiles like marble or travertine; opt for a pH-neutral stone cleaner instead. For old sealant, use a utility knife or scraper to carefully lift and peel it away, taking care not to scratch the tile surface.

Once cleaned, rinse the tiles thoroughly with warm water to remove all residue. A squeegee can help ensure no cleaner or debris remains in grout lines. Allow the tiles to dry completely—at least 24 hours in a well-ventilated area. Moisture trapped beneath the sealant can cause clouding or mold growth. If time is a constraint, use a hairdryer on a low setting, but ensure the surface is fully dry to the touch.

The final step is to inspect the tiles for any missed spots. Run your hand over the surface to detect rough patches or remaining sealant. Grout lines should be particularly scrutinized, as they often harbor hidden grime. If necessary, repeat the cleaning process until the tiles are uniformly clean and smooth. This meticulous preparation ensures the sealant adheres evenly, creating a durable barrier against water and stains.

Skipping this step or rushing through it undermines the entire sealing process. Think of it as laying the foundation for a house—a strong base guarantees longevity. By investing time in thorough cleaning and inspection, you’ll achieve a professional finish that protects your shower tiles for years to come.

Choose Sealant: Select grout or tile sealant based on material type and bathroom moisture levels

Selecting the right sealant for your shower tiles is crucial, as it directly impacts the longevity and appearance of your bathroom. The first step is to identify the material of your tiles and grout, as different materials require specific types of sealants. For instance, natural stone tiles like marble or granite are porous and need a penetrating sealant to protect against moisture and stains. In contrast, ceramic or porcelain tiles, being less porous, may only require a surface sealant to enhance their water resistance. Understanding the material type ensures you choose a sealant that bonds effectively and provides the necessary protection.

Bathroom moisture levels play a pivotal role in sealant selection. High-moisture environments, such as showers with poor ventilation, demand a more robust sealant with advanced water-repelling properties. Silicone-based sealants are often recommended for these areas due to their flexibility and resistance to mold and mildew. For moderate moisture levels, a water-based grout sealer can suffice, offering adequate protection without the strong odor associated with solvent-based options. Always consider the humidity and ventilation of your bathroom to avoid premature sealant failure.

When applying the sealant, follow the manufacturer’s instructions carefully. Typically, grout sealers require a clean, dry surface and should be applied with a small brush or applicator bottle. For tile sealants, ensure the product is evenly spread and allowed to penetrate for the recommended time before wiping off excess. A common mistake is over-application, which can lead to a cloudy finish or reduced adhesion. Test the sealant on a small, inconspicuous area first to ensure compatibility and desired results.

Comparing grout and tile sealants reveals distinct purposes. Grout sealers focus on protecting the porous grout lines from water infiltration and staining, while tile sealants enhance the tile’s surface durability and appearance. In high-moisture areas, using both types of sealants can provide comprehensive protection. However, for low-moisture bathrooms or less porous tiles, a grout sealer alone may be sufficient. Assess your specific needs to avoid unnecessary costs or over-sealing.

Finally, maintenance is key to prolonging the life of your sealant. Reapply grout sealer every 1-2 years, depending on moisture exposure and wear. Tile sealants may last longer, typically 3-5 years, but inspect them annually for signs of degradation. Regular cleaning with mild, pH-neutral cleaners helps preserve the sealant’s integrity. By choosing the right sealant and maintaining it properly, you can keep your shower tiles looking pristine and functional for years to come.

Apply Sealant: Use a brush or roller, ensuring even coverage without pooling or gaps

Applying sealant to shower tiles is a critical step in protecting your investment and ensuring longevity. The method of application—whether using a brush or roller—directly impacts the effectiveness of the sealant. A brush offers precision, allowing you to navigate grout lines and tile edges with ease, while a roller provides efficiency for larger, flat surfaces. The key lies in achieving even coverage, as missed spots or thin layers can compromise the barrier against moisture. Pooling, on the other hand, not only wastes product but can also lead to uneven drying and potential discoloration. Striking this balance requires patience and attention to detail, but the payoff is a waterproof surface that resists mold, mildew, and water damage.

Consider the type of sealant you’re working with, as this influences your application technique. Silicone-based sealants, for instance, are best applied with a brush due to their thicker consistency, while water-based sealants may spread more evenly with a roller. Regardless of the tool, start by working in small sections, typically 2–3 square feet at a time. Dip your brush or roller lightly into the sealant, removing excess to avoid over-application. For grout lines, use the tip of the brush to press sealant into the crevices, ensuring full penetration. On tile surfaces, use long, even strokes with a roller, overlapping each pass slightly to maintain consistency. Always follow the manufacturer’s instructions for drying times and recoating, as these vary by product.

One common mistake is rushing the process, which often results in gaps or streaks. To avoid this, maintain a steady pace and inspect each section before moving on. If you notice pooling, gently redistribute the sealant with your tool or a clean cloth. Conversely, if you spot gaps, reapply a thin layer, focusing on the affected area. Lighting plays a crucial role here—position a bright light source at an angle to reveal imperfections that might otherwise go unnoticed. This methodical approach ensures a professional finish, even for DIY enthusiasts.

While brushes and rollers are the primary tools, accessories can enhance your results. A foam brush, for example, minimizes lint residue compared to traditional bristle brushes, making it ideal for smooth tiles. For textured surfaces, a roller with a medium nap (around ¼ inch) adapts better to uneven contours. Additionally, masking tape can protect adjacent areas like fixtures or walls from accidental sealant contact. Clean your tools immediately after use with the solvent recommended by the sealant manufacturer to preserve their lifespan.

In conclusion, the application of sealant is as much an art as it is a science. By choosing the right tool, working methodically, and paying attention to detail, you can achieve a flawless seal that safeguards your shower tiles for years to come. Remember, the goal isn’t just to apply sealant—it’s to apply it *correctly*. With practice and the right techniques, you’ll master this essential step in tile maintenance.

Dry and Cure: Follow product instructions for drying time, typically 24-48 hours, before using shower

After applying a sealant to your shower tiles, patience is your greatest ally. The drying and curing process is critical to ensuring the sealant adheres properly and provides long-lasting protection against water damage and mold. Most sealants require a drying time of 24 to 48 hours, but this can vary depending on the product and environmental conditions. Always refer to the manufacturer’s instructions for specific guidelines, as some sealants may need even longer to fully cure, especially in humid or cold environments.

Skipping this waiting period can compromise the sealant’s effectiveness. For instance, using the shower too soon can cause the sealant to smear, peel, or fail to bond correctly, leaving your grout and tiles vulnerable. To avoid this, plan ahead and schedule the sealing process when you can go without using the shower for at least two days. If you have multiple bathrooms, this is straightforward; if not, consider using a gym or arranging temporary access to another shower facility.

Environmental factors play a significant role in drying time. High humidity or low temperatures can slow the curing process, potentially extending the wait beyond 48 hours. To expedite drying, ensure the bathroom is well-ventilated by opening windows or using a fan. Avoid using heaters or hairdryers directly on the tiles, as excessive heat can cause uneven drying and damage the sealant. Instead, maintain a consistent room temperature of around 65–75°F (18–24°C) for optimal results.

Once the drying period is complete, inspect the tiles and grout lines to ensure the sealant has cured evenly. Look for any missed spots or areas where the sealant appears thin, as these may require a second application. If the sealant feels tacky or soft to the touch, it’s not fully cured, and you’ll need to wait longer. Only when the surface is completely dry and firm should you resume using the shower. This careful approach ensures the sealant performs as intended, protecting your tiles and grout for years to come.

Maintain Sealant: Reapply sealant annually or as needed to prevent water damage and mold growth

Shower sealant degrades over time, especially in high-moisture environments. Silicone, a common sealant, typically lasts 5–10 years, but grout sealant may need reapplication every 1–2 years. Factors like humidity, cleaning chemicals, and physical wear accelerate breakdown. Inspect your sealant annually for cracks, peeling, or discoloration—signs it’s no longer effective. Ignoring these warnings leaves grout porous, allowing water to seep behind tiles and foster mold or structural damage.

Reapplying sealant is straightforward but requires precision. First, remove old sealant using a utility knife or sealant remover tool, taking care not to scratch tiles. Clean the area with isopropyl alcohol to ensure adhesion. Apply new sealant in a smooth, continuous bead, using a caulking gun with a nozzle sized for your grout lines. For corners, opt for a 50/50 silicone blend for flexibility. Allow 24 hours for curing, avoiding water exposure during this period. Pro tip: Use painter’s tape along tile edges for clean lines, removing it immediately after application.

Comparing sealant types reveals trade-offs. Silicone is waterproof and flexible but can trap moisture beneath the surface. Epoxy grout sealant is more durable and stain-resistant but less forgiving during application. For showers, 100% silicone is often ideal due to its mold resistance and ease of use. However, if grout is already stained, consider a tinted sealant to refresh the look while protecting. Cost varies: a standard tube of silicone runs $5–$10, while epoxy can cost $20–$30 per tube.

Annual reapplication isn’t just maintenance—it’s prevention. Water damage repairs can cost thousands, dwarfing the $10–$50 investment in sealant and tools. Mold remediation averages $500–$6,000, depending on severity. By dedicating an hour yearly to this task, you safeguard your shower’s integrity and avoid costly surprises. Think of it as an insurance policy for your bathroom, preserving both aesthetics and structural health.

For those in humid climates or with older showers, more frequent checks are prudent. After heavy use or cleaning with abrasive agents, inspect sealant monthly. Keep a spare tube of sealant on hand for spot repairs. Pair this routine with grout cleaning every 6–12 months using a mild bleach solution (1 part bleach to 10 parts water) to inhibit mold. Consistency is key: small, regular efforts prevent the need for major interventions later.

The best way to seal shower tiles is to use a high-quality, penetrating tile and grout sealer. Clean the tiles thoroughly, allow them to dry completely, and then apply the sealer evenly using a brush, roller, or spray bottle. Follow the manufacturer’s instructions for application and drying times.

Shower tiles should be sealed every 1 to 3 years, depending on usage and the type of sealer used. High-traffic showers or those exposed to harsh cleaning chemicals may require more frequent sealing. Test the grout’s water absorption annually to determine if resealing is needed.

Sealing shower tiles is a DIY-friendly task if you follow the proper steps and use the right products. However, if you’re unsure or dealing with extensive tilework, hiring a professional can ensure the job is done correctly and efficiently.

Before sealing shower tiles, thoroughly clean the tiles and grout to remove soap scum, mildew, and dirt. Use a mild detergent or tile cleaner, scrub the surfaces, and rinse well. Allow the tiles to dry completely for at least 24 hours to ensure the sealer adheres properly.
